wt.query.qml
Class ClassDisplayInfo

java.lang.Object
  extended bywt.query.qml.DisplayNameInfo
      extended bywt.query.qml.ClassDisplayInfo

public class ClassDisplayInfo
extends DisplayNameInfo


Field Summary
private static ClassDisplayInfo links
           
private static ClassDisplayInfo references
           
 
Fields inherited from class wt.query.qml.DisplayNameInfo
 
Constructor Summary
ClassDisplayInfo(String a_parentClassName, boolean a_isPersistable, Locale a_locale)
           
ClassDisplayInfo(String a_parentClassName, Locale a_locale)
           
 
Method Summary
 void buildClassInfos(String a_className, boolean a_isPersistable, Locale a_locale)
           
static ClassDisplayInfo getBinaryLinks(Locale a_locale)
           
 ClassInfo getDisplayClassInfo(String a_displayName)
           
 String getDisplayClassName(String a_displayName)
           
 String getDisplayName(Class a_class)
           
 String getDisplayName(ClassInfo a_classInfo)
           
 String getDisplayName(Object a_object)
           
static ClassDisplayInfo getReferences(Locale a_locale)
           
 
Methods inherited from class wt.query.qml.DisplayNameInfo
addItem, getDisplayItem, getDisplayNames, size, toString, verifyCurrentLocale
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

references

private static ClassDisplayInfo references

links

private static ClassDisplayInfo links
Constructor Detail

ClassDisplayInfo

public ClassDisplayInfo(String a_parentClassName,
                        Locale a_locale)
                 throws WTIntrospectionException

ClassDisplayInfo

public ClassDisplayInfo(String a_parentClassName,
                        boolean a_isPersistable,
                        Locale a_locale)
                 throws WTIntrospectionException
Method Detail

getReferences

public static ClassDisplayInfo getReferences(Locale a_locale)
                                      throws WTIntrospectionException
Throws:
WTIntrospectionException

getBinaryLinks

public static ClassDisplayInfo getBinaryLinks(Locale a_locale)
                                       throws WTIntrospectionException
Throws:
WTIntrospectionException

getDisplayName

public String getDisplayName(Object a_object)
Overrides:
getDisplayName in class DisplayNameInfo

getDisplayName

public String getDisplayName(Class a_class)

getDisplayName

public String getDisplayName(ClassInfo a_classInfo)

getDisplayClassName

public String getDisplayClassName(String a_displayName)

getDisplayClassInfo

public ClassInfo getDisplayClassInfo(String a_displayName)

buildClassInfos

public void buildClassInfos(String a_className,
                            boolean a_isPersistable,
                            Locale a_locale)
                     throws WTIntrospectionException
Throws:
WTIntrospectionException